填充已关闭使用HTML5 Canvas

时间:2013-07-23 14:03:47

标签: javascript html5 canvas

我使用html5画布绘制了一些图形。

var ctx = document.getElementById('canvas').getContext('2d');
ctx.stroke = "red";
ctx.beginPath();
ctx.moveTo(30, 30);
ctx.lineTo(150, 150);
ctx.bezierCurveTo(60, 70, 60, 70, 70, 150);
ctx.lineTo(30, 30);
ctx.fill();

当我点击画布区域时,如果点击点位于封闭区域,我想用红色填充封闭区域。

请帮帮我

1 个答案:

答案 0 :(得分:0)

ctx.fillStyle = 'red';

http://jsfiddle.net/zsal/FfdCe/2/

这是一个jsfiddle,你的画布在悬停时填充为红色。